To begin, gather your materials: a foam ball or clay as your base for the cell body, colorful modeling clay, beads, pipe cleaners, and labels. Start by shaping the central structure—the cytoplasm—using the foam ball. Next, add the nucleus by placing a smaller ball or bead at the center; this represents the cell's control center. For organelles such as mitochondria, Golgi apparatus, and endoplasmic reticulum, use differently colored clay pieces and arrange them thoughtfully to mimic their real-life locations within the cell. Utilize pipe cleaners for structures like microtubules and flagella, if applicable. Don't forget the cell membrane, which can be outlined with a thin layer of clay or even a rubber band. As you assemble the model, attach small labels to each organelle for educational clarity. Once complete, your 3D cell model will be a vivid demonstration of cell anatomy, making complex biological components easy to understand. Q: How should the organelles be arranged inside the cell model?A: Organelles should be placed with consideration to their relative positions in actual cells, starting with the nucleus at the center and arranging others like mitochondria and Golgi apparatus around it. Q: Can I make a cell model using only household items?A: Yes, many household items like buttons, rubber bands, cotton balls, and bottle caps can be repurposed for different cell components. Q: How can labeling improve my cell model?A: Labels clarify the function and identity of each organelle, making your model an effective educational tool for presentations or study.
